一.初识Linux 1-3操作系统概述&Linux初识&虚拟机介绍


目录

[一.初识Linux 1.操作系统概述](#一.初识Linux 1.操作系统概述)

计算机组成

硬件:

软件:

操作系统:

操作系统工作流程

操作系统作用

常见的操作系统

PC端:

移动端:(掌上操作系统)

[一.初识Linux 2.Linux初识](#一.初识Linux 2.Linux初识)

linux系统的诞生

Linux内核

Linux发行版

[一.初识Linux 3.虚拟机介绍](#一.初识Linux 3.虚拟机介绍)

虚拟机



一.初识Linux 1.操作系统概述

计算机组成

计算机:硬件和软件组成。

硬件:

(看的到的,摸得到的。)计算机系统中由电子,机械,光电软元件等组成的各种物理装置的总称。

软件:

用户和计算机硬件之间的接口和桥梁。--用户通过软件与计算机进行交流。

------而操作系统,就是软件的一类!!!

计算机:操作系统+硬件


操作系统:

主要负责桥梁啊,调度和管理计算机硬件进行工作。

操作系统调度CPU,内存,......

操作系统工作流程

操作系统作用

用户和计算机硬件之间的接口和桥梁,调度和管理计算机硬件进行工作。

------------用户使用操作系统,操作系统安排硬件干活------------------------

常见的操作系统

PC端:

windows11

Linux

macOS

移动端:(掌上操作系统)

安卓

ios

HarmoneyOS(华为鸿蒙操作系统)


一.初识Linux 2.Linux初识


linux系统的诞生

Linux内核

内核提供了Linux系统的主要功能,如硬件调度的管理功能。

例子:------播放音乐时:

程序调用内核,内核调度硬件CPU进行解码,调度外设音响。

免费开源:不要钱,源代码公开。(任何人都可以查看,甚至贡献源代码)

The Linux Kernel Archives

Linux发行版

内核无法被用户直接使用,需要配合应用程序才能被用户使用。

修改后的内核 +封装系统级程序(软件)=Linux发行版

------------因而Linux发行版就很多了------


一.初识Linux 3.虚拟机介绍


虚拟机

通过虚拟化技术,在电脑内,虚拟出计算机硬件,并给虚拟的硬件安装操作系统,即可得到一台虚拟的电脑,称之为虚拟机。

centos7

相关推荐
bwz999@88.com19 分钟前
ubuntu24.04更换国内源
linux·运维·服务器
腾科IT教育21 分钟前
红帽认证考试全国考点信息新发布,便捷参考
运维·服务器·红帽认证·linux考试·rhcsa考试
历程里程碑25 分钟前
Protobuf 环境搭建:Windows 与 Linux 系统安装教程
linux·运维·数据结构·windows·线性代数·算法·矩阵
软件资深者27 分钟前
OpenClaw 本地安装 vs 网页版龙虾:全方位对比 + 2026 最新一键安装客户端(新手零门槛搭建专属 AI 助理)
运维·人工智能·自动化·飞书·数字员工·openclaw·龙虾
XXOOXRT28 分钟前
Ubuntu搭建Java项目运行环境(JDK17+MySQL8.0)超详细教程
java·linux·mysql·ubuntu
吴声子夜歌29 分钟前
TypeScript——类型基础(二)
linux·ubuntu·typescript
vvw&35 分钟前
如何从 Ubuntu 24.04 升级到 Ubuntu 25.04
linux·运维·服务器·ubuntu
CDN36037 分钟前
CSDN 交流|360CDN 系列产品使用感受与避坑建议
运维·网络安全
CDN36038 分钟前
源站防护升级:360CDN 高防服务器部署与优化
运维·服务器
qzhqbb1 小时前
Web 服务器(Nginx、Apache)
服务器·前端·nginx